linux软连接命令目录linux软连接命令

Linux中如何在当前目录下创建到/var目录的软链接?

命令:ln-s/varlinkdir(linktdir是你要链接的文件)

1.如果linkdir已经创建并且是一个目录,则执行上述命令后,会创建一个名为var的文件,指向/var2。
如果创建了linkdir并且是一个文件,则仅当指定的名称不存在时才会在当前文件中创建一个新文件。
它是一个目录并附加到/var。

3.ln-s/var(即在当前目录下创建一个指向/var的var文件)与1类似。
运行ls-l可以看到当前目录中的var->/var显示。
第二种方法通常是直接命名链接文件。

Linux中软连接和硬连接的区别和作用是什么?

区别

(1)软链接可以跨文件系统,而硬链接则不能。

(2)这是一道关于I节点的问题。
无论有多少个硬连接,它们都指向同一个I节点,这样就增加了节点连接的数量。
除非节点连接数为零,否则无论删除与否,文件都会一直存在。
源文件或链接文件。
只要文件存在,文件就存在(事实上,哪个源文件链接它们并不重要,因为它们都指向同一个I节点)。
如果修改源文件或链接文件,其他文件也会同时修改。
软链接不直接使用i节点号作为文件指针,而是使用文件路径名作为指针。
因此,删除链接文件不会对源文件产生任何影响,但如果删除源文件,链接文件将无法找到它试图指向的文件。
软链接有自己的索引节点和磁盘上的一小块空间来存储路径名。

(3)软链接可以连接不存在的文件名。

(4)软链接可以链接目录

作用

硬链接:与普通文件没有什么不同,inode可以链接硬盘块上的相同文件。
观点。

软链接:存储其所代表的文件的绝对路径。
另一种类型的文件,作为硬盘上的独立块存在,并在访问时更改其路径。

【linux】循序渐进学运维-基础篇-文件的软硬链接

本文主要介绍Linux文件的硬链接和软链接。
在Linux中,链接分为两种:硬链接和软链接。
可以通过ln命令创建链接。
硬链接是指通过inode号连接文件。
文件名映射到文件。
inode节点上的链接数就是硬链接数。
硬链接不共享文件内容,删除一个文件不会影响另一个文件。
符号链接类似于Windows快捷方式,实际上是一个特殊的文本文件,其中包含有关目标文件位置的信息。
使用ln-s命令创建软件连接。
可以在分区之间创建符号链接,但如果在创建符号链接时未使用绝对路径,则可能会导致错误。
分区之间不能创建硬链接。
删除原文件后,符号链接将失效。
符号链接在实际工作中有着广泛的应用。
通过实践,您可以更直观地了解硬链接和软链接的区别和用法。
硬链接提供了一种备份功能,即使一个文件被意外删除,另一个文件仍然存在。
软件连接提供了从不同位置访问文件的快捷方式。
需要注意的是,创建符号链接时应使用绝对路径,以避免分区之间出现错误。
综上所述,软件和物理链路的使用都比较简单,通过实践即可掌握其特点和应用。

【linux】循序渐进学运维-基础篇-文件的软硬链接

【Linux基础运维】深入理解文件硬链接和软链接

本文介绍了Linux中两种重要的文件链接类型:硬链接(HardLinks)和硬链接。
软链接(SymbolicLinks,也称软连接)。

硬链接和软链接的区别

硬链接是由索引节点号创建的链接,多个文件名共享同一个inode。
如果源文件被删除,其他硬链接文件将继续照常可用,但其内容不会受到影响。
例如:

创建硬链接:多个文件指向同一个索引节点,删除一个文件不会影响其他文件。
硬链接限制:不能跨分区创建(虽然有些信息可能会误导你认为不能跨目录,虽然在实际测试中是可以跨目录的)。

软链接类似于Windows快捷方式,是一个存储另一个文件路径的文本文件。
使用ln-s命令创建软链接。
其特点是:

软链接练习

1.原文件删除后软链接失效。
软链接高度依赖以下文件:删除原始文件会破坏软链接。

2.创建软链接:可以跨分区,但必须使用绝对路径。
一个正确的例子是:

软链接删除原文件:原文件被删除,软链接消失。
创建分区之间的软链接:正确使用绝对路径来实现分区之间的链接。
概述

软链接在日常运维中比较常见。
硬链接和软链接看似简单,但了解其工作原理和限制对于运维工作至关重要。
通过一些练习,您将很快掌握这两个链接的使用。